使用Docker添加字体到OnlyOffice

在使用OnlyOffice进行文档处理时,有时候我们需要添加额外的字体以确保文档的正确显示。这篇文章将介绍如何使用Docker在OnlyOffice中添加字体。

Docker简介

Docker是一个开源的容器化平台,用于轻松地打包、分发和运行应用程序。它允许我们使用容器来封装应用程序和它们的依赖,以便在不同的环境中进行部署。

OnlyOffice Docker

OnlyOffice提供了一个基于Docker的部署方式,使得我们可以快速搭建和扩展在线办公环境。在OnlyOffice Docker中,我们可以使用一些特定的配置来添加自定义字体。

添加字体到OnlyOffice Docker

以下是将字体添加到OnlyOffice Docker的步骤:

  1. 准备字体文件

    在添加字体之前,我们需要准备字体文件。可以从公共字体库中下载所需的字体文件,或者从其他来源获取。

  2. 打开OnlyOffice Docker配置文件

    使用任何文本编辑器打开OnlyOffice Docker配置文件 docker-compose.yml

  3. 找到并编辑字体配置

    在配置文件中,找到以下部分:

    services:
      documentserver:
        environment:
          - fonts: ""
    

    修改 fonts 字段的值为我们需要添加的字体文件路径。多个字体文件可以用逗号分隔。例如:

    services:
      documentserver:
        environment:
          - fonts: "/usr/share/fonts/customfont.ttf"
    
  4. 构建和运行OnlyOffice Docker容器

    在完成字体配置后,构建和运行OnlyOffice Docker容器:

    $ docker-compose up -d
    

    Docker将根据配置文件构建和启动OnlyOffice容器,并自动添加字体文件。

  5. 验证字体是否添加成功

    可以通过访问OnlyOffice的Web界面来验证字体是否成功添加。在打开任何文档时,只需选择所添加的字体即可。

总结

使用Docker添加字体到OnlyOffice非常简单。在配置文件中指定字体文件的路径,重新构建和运行OnlyOffice容器即可。这样,我们就可以确保OnlyOffice在处理文档时能够正确显示所需的字体。

希望本文能够帮助你成功添加字体到OnlyOffice Docker,并享受更好的文档处理体验。


参考资料:

  • [OnlyOffice官方文档](
  • [Docker官方文档](